Piping The Earth

Published Jan. 21, 2016

(Ravello Records) The title of this orchestral album by Judith Shatin *79 is from an ancient Chinese text, referencing the dual nature of wind — its myriad sounds as it travels across the earth, and its underlying intransience. This one-movement titular piece analogously flows from one sound space to another, while keeping a constant harmonic background; the three other pieces on the CD combine Shatin’s inventive approach to sound with a strong sense of musicianship. Shatin is a composer and sound artist, whose music has been commissioned by numerous organizations.
